The Financial Services Council has appointed a number of top dogs in the wealth management industry from AMP, Commonwealth Bank’s NewCo and Challenger, as BT chief executive Brad Cooper exits from his role as FSC deputy chairman.

David Bryant, chief executive and chief investment officer for Australian Unity Group will be replacing Mr Cooper who is stepping down after nine years on the board.

Meanwhile, the FSC has welcomed newcomers Alex Wade, CEO of AMP’s Australian Wealth Management, Andrew Tobin, chief financial officer of Challenger and Jason Yetton, chief executive.

MLC Wealth chief executive and FSC chairman Geoff Lloyd said during Mr Cooper’s tenure, he provided expert guidance and support, particularly during challenging periods for the industry.

Mr Tobin of Challenger has worked in the banking, insurance and wealth management industries in Australia and Asia for more than 25 years.

Mr Wade of AMP has experience in banking and wealth management both in Australia and overseas, while Mr Yetton of NewCo has a background across banking, funds and wealth management.
